The Rising of the Shield Hero Season 5 Teaser Released: Returning in 2027

The Rising of the Shield Hero fans have great news! The official teaser for the series has been released, and it has been confirmed that the fifth season will air in 2027. According to Anime News Network, the production team from the fourth season will continue unchanged.
While the teaser visuals show Naofumi Iwatani and his team preparing for new adventures, it is a matter of curiosity where the story will go after the major battles remaining from the fourth season. Takao Abo (first two seasons and fourth season) will again be in the director's chair. The joint production by Studio Kinema Citrus and DR Movie continues.
As a reminder: Tate no Yuusha no Nariagari (The Rising of the Shield Hero) is based on the light novel series of the same name by Aneko Yusagi. The first season aired in 2019, the second in 2022, and the third in 2023. The fourth season has not yet been released; it was originally expected to air in the second half of 2025, but the studio experienced delays in its schedule.
Now, about the fifth season: The official teaser shows that the series is ready for a long journey. While the light novel series has surpassed 22 volumes, the anime currently covers approximately volumes 15-16. So the studio has plenty of material.
